Also, adjusting the length of the pushrod between the master cylinder and booster does wonders to how much pedal travel and feel you get.

With the leather shims I would say that these would be in the booster under the pushrod, it's called a reaction disc, and if it is worn out, missing, too small etc pedal feel and effectiveness become a bit strange. What happens with a lot of people is they take the master cylinder out, accidently bump the brake pedal, pushrod comes out and the reaction disc falls off (into the booster). Reassemble and hey wow my brakes are weird.

AFAIK most Toyota boosters don't have removable reaction discs (thankfully), so you needn't worry about this. Just screw the little nipple on the top of the pushrod in and out to adjust the length.
